Stanley Druckenmiller is buying shares in the following 3 airlines

Stanley Druckenmiller, a renowned billionaire investor, is known for his ability to perceive economic trends and adjust his investment strategy accordingly. He has focused on various sectors in the past, both technology stocks and financials, and has always tried to adapt his portfolio to current market conditions. In recent months, however, he has decided to focus on the aerospace industry, which has experienced a strong recovery following the COVID-19 pandemic.

As part of this trend, Druckenmiller has decided to include in his portfolio the shares of three major airlines: United Airlines, Delta Airlines and American Airlines.

In 2024, specifically in the fourth quarter, his Duquesne Family Office fund purchased more than one million shares of these three airline giants, making him a major investor in the sector.
